Работа с иностранной валютой в 1С:Предприятие 8.3 требует особого внимания к настройке планов счетов и аналитического учета. Валютные счета организации — это не просто техническая деталь, а основа для корректного отражения операций в рублевом эквиваленте, расчета курсовой разницы и формирования отчетности по стандартам МСФО или РСБУ. Ошибки на этом этапе приводят к искажению финансовых результатов, проблемам с налоговыми органами и сложностям при аудите.
В этой статье мы разберем пошаговый алгоритм создания валютного счета в типовой конфигурации 1С:Бухгалтерия 8.3 (редакция 3.0), включая нюансы для разных валют (доллар, евро, юань) и особенности учета в 1С:ERP. Особое внимание уделим настройке субконто, привязке к банковским выпискам и автоматическому пересчету курсов. Если вы работаете с несколькими валютами или ведете учет по ПБУ 3/2006, эта инструкция поможет избежать типичных ошибок.
⚠️ Важно! Перед созданием валютных счетов убедитесь, что в справочнике Валюты (Справочники → Валюты) добавлены все необходимые валюты с актуальными курсами. Курсы ЦБ РФ обновляются автоматически при подключении к сервису 1С:Облачный курс валют, но для точности рекомендуем сверять данные с официальным сайтом Банка России в день операции.
1. Подготовка системы: проверка настроек учета
Прежде чем создавать валютный счет, необходимо убедиться, что конфигурация поддерживает многовалютный учет. В 1С:Бухгалтерия 8.3 это включается по умолчанию, но в некоторых отраслевых решениях или устаревших редакциях может потребоваться ручная настройка.
Откройте раздел Главное → Настройки → Функциональность и проверьте:
- 📌 Валютный учет — флажок должен быть установлен.
- 📌 Учет по международным стандартам (МСФО) — если ведете параллельный учет.
- 📌 Использовать несколько организаций — если валютные счета нужны для конкретного юрлица.
Если флажок Валютный учет отсутствует или заблокирован, это означает, что ваша конфигурация не поддерживает работу с валютами. В этом случае потребуется обновление или доработка через Конфигуратор.
Если вы работаете в 1С:ERP, проверьте настройки в разделе НСИ и администрирование → Организации → Настройки учета. Здесь можно гибко настроить аналитику по валютам для каждого подразделения отдельно.
2. Добавление валют в справочник
Валютный счет всегда привязан к конкретной валюте, поэтому сначала необходимо заполнить справочник Валюты. Перейдите в Справочники → Валюты и проверьте наличие нужных валют (доллар США, евро, юань и т.д.). Если какой-то валюты нет, добавьте её вручную:
Алгоритм добавления новой валюты:
- Нажмите
Создать. - Укажите Код (например,
USDдля доллара). - Заполните Наименование (полное и краткое).
- В поле Кратность укажите
1(для большинства валют). - Вкладка Курсы валют — добавьте актуальный курс (можно загрузить автоматически через
Загрузить курсы).
⚠️ Внимание! Если валюта уже есть в справочнике, но курсы устарели, обновите их через Если курс в 1С отличается от курса по банковской выписке, создайте ручную операцию переоценки через документ Загрузить курсы валют (кнопка в верхней панели справочника). Для корректного учета курсовой разницы важно, чтобы курсы совпадали с датами операций.
Что делать, если курс валюты в 1С не совпадает с курсом банка?
Корректировка долга или Операция (бухгалтерский и налоговый учет). В комментарии укажите причину расхождения (например, "Курс банка на дату операции — 92.50 руб/USD").
3. Создание валютного счета в плане счетов
Валютные счета в 1С создаются на основе стандартного плана счетов, но с привязкой к конкретной валюте. Для этого:
Шаг 1. Откройте Главное → План счетов (или Операции → План счетов в старых редакциях).
Шаг 2. Найдите счет 52 "Валютные счета" и дважды кликните по нему. В открывшейся форме нажмите Создать субсчет.
Параметры нового субсчета:
- 📝 Наименование — укажите назначение (например, "Валютный счет в долларах США, Альфа-Банк").
- 💰 Валюта — выберите валюту из справочника (например,
USD). - 📊 Субконто — добавьте аналитику:
- 🏦 Банковские счета (обязательно, если ведете учет по нескольким счетам в одном банке).
- 📄 Договоры (если нужно разделять операции по договорам).
- 🔄 Валютный — флажок должен быть установлен автоматически при выборе валюты.
⚠️ Внимание! Если вы создаете счет для 1С:ERP, дополнительно укажите Подразделение и Проект (если ведете учет по центрам финансовой ответственности).
Код счета соответствует стандарту (например, 52.01)|Валюта выбрана корректно|Указан банковский счет (субконто)|Установлен флажок "Валютный"|Добавлены необходимые аналитики (договоры, подразделения)
-->
4. Настройка аналитики: субконто и дополнительные реквизиты
Для детализации операций по валютному счету используются субконто — аналитические разрезы. Без них невозможно разделить операции по контрагентам, договорам или банковским счетам. Рассмотрим ключевые настройки:
Основные субконто для валютных счетов:
| Субконто | Назначение | Обязательно? |
|---|---|---|
| Банковские счета | Разделение операций по разным счетам в одном банке (например, текущий и транзитный) | Да |
| Контрагенты | Учет операций по каждому партнеру (поставщики, покупатели) | Да |
| Договоры | Привязка платежей к конкретным договорам (важно для учета авансов) | Нет |
| Статьи движения денежных средств | Классификация операций (оплата поставщику, возвраты, прочие расходы) | Рекомендуется |
Для добавления субконто:
- Откройте карточку счета
52.XX. - Перейдите на вкладку Субконто.
- Нажмите
Добавитьи выберите нужный вид субконто из справочника. - Укажите Тип субконто (например,
КонтрагентыилиБанковские счета).
⚠️ Внимание! Если вы ведете учет по ПБУ 18/02 (учет постоянных и временных разниц), добавьте субконто Виды расчетов с контрагентами для корректного формирования отложенных налогов.
5. Привязка к банковскому счету и реквизитам организации
Валютный счет в 1С должен быть связан с реальным банковским счетом организации. Для этого:
Шаг 1. Откройте справочник Банковские счета (Справочники → Банковские счета) и создайте новый элемент.
Шаг 2. Заполните реквизиты:
- 🏢 Организация — выберите юрлицо, для которого открыт счет.
- 🏦 Банк — укажите банк из справочника
Банки(если его нет, добавьте черезСправочники → Банки). - 💳 Номер счета — введите номер валютного счета (например,
40702810900000001234). - 🌍 Валюта счета — выберите валюту (должна совпадать с валютой счета в плане счетов).
- 📅 Дата открытия/закрытия — укажите актуальные даты.
Шаг 3. Вернитесь к счету 52.XX в плане счетов и на вкладке Субконто привяжите созданный банковский счет.
Без привязки к банковскому счету в справочнике вы не сможете формировать платежные поручения и загружать выписки из клиент-банка.
6. Проводки и курсовой пересчет: как избежать ошибок
После создания валютного счета все операции по нему будут автоматически пересчитываться в рубли по курсу на дату операции. Однако есть нюансы, которые часто упускают:
Типичные ошибки и их решения:
- 🔴 Курс не обновлен → Перед проведением документа проверьте актуальность курса в справочнике
Валюты. - 🔴 Неверная аналитика → Убедитесь, что в платежном документе указано субконто Банковский счет и Контрагент.
- 🔴 Расхождения с банком → Сверяйте остатки по счету
52с выпиской банка еженедельно.
Для ручного пересчета курсовой разницы используйте документ Корректировка долга (Покупки → Корректировка долга или Продажи → Корректировка долга). Алгоритм:
- Выберите Вид операции — "Корректировка долга в валюте".
- Укажите Контрагента и Договор.
- Введите Сумму в валюте и Курс пересчета.
- Нажмите
Провести и закрыть.
Критическая деталь: если курсовую разницу не отразить своевременно, финансовый результат в отчете о прибылях и убытках (форма №2) будет искажен. Особенно это важно для компаний, работающих с крупными валютными остатками.
7. Автоматизация: загрузка выписок и интеграция с клиент-банком
Чтобы упростить работу с валютными счетами, настройте автоматическую загрузку выписок из клиент-банка. В 1С:Бухгалтерия 8.3 это делается через Банк и касса → Банковские выписки → Загрузить выписку.
Поддерживаемые форматы:
- 📄
1С:ДиректБанк(универсальный формат для большинства банков). - 📄
SWIFT MT940(международный стандарт). - 📄
ExcelилиCSV(для ручной выгрузки из банка).
Для настройки интеграции:
- Перейдите в
Администрирование → Обмен с банками. - Выберите свой банк из списка или настройте новое подключение.
- Укажите Логин, Пароль и Режимы обмена (автоматический/ручной).
- Сохраните настройки и выполните тестовое подключение.
⚠️ Внимание! При загрузке валютных выписок проверяйте:
- Совпадение курса в выписке и в 1С.
- Корректность привязки платежей к договорам.
- Отсутствие дублей операций.
Если ваш банк не поддерживает прямую интеграцию, используйте промежуточный формат Excel. Для этого в 1С есть обработка Универсальный обмен данными в формате XML/Excel (Файл → Открыть…).
FAQ: Частые вопросы по валютным счетам в 1С
Как отразить комиссию банка за обслуживание валютного счета?
Комиссия банка учитывается как прочие расходы. Создайте документ Списание с расчетного счета (Банк и касса → Банковские выписки → Списание) с проводкой:
Дт 91.02 "Прочие расходы" — Кт 52.XX "Валютный счет"
Укажите статью движения денежных средств "Комиссии банка" и прикрепите скан-копию выписки.
Можно ли вести учет по нескольким валютам на одном счете 52?
Нет, для каждой валюты должен быть отдельный субсчет (например, 52.01 — доллары, 52.02 — евро). Это требование ПБУ 3/2006 и стандартов бухгалтерского учета. Смешивание валют на одном счете приведет к ошибкам в пересчете курсовой разницы.
Как исправить ошибку "Не указан курс валюты" при проведении документа?
Ошибка возникает, если в справочнике Валюты отсутствует курс на дату операции. Решения:
- Обновите курсы через
Загрузить курсы валют. - Добавьте курс вручную для нужной даты.
- Проверьте, что в документе указана корректная дата (не будущая).
Нужно ли создавать отдельный валютный счет для каждого банка?
Да, если у вас несколько валютных счетов в разных банках. Например:
52.01— доллары, Сбербанк.52.02— доллары, Альфа-Банк.52.03— евро, ВТБ.
Это упростит аналитику и отчетность по каждому банку отдельно.
Как отразить покупку валюты через банк?
Используйте документ Поступление на расчетный счет (Банк и касса → Банковские выписки → Поступление) с видом операции "Покупка иностранной валюты". Проводки формируются автоматически:
Дт 52.XX "Валютный счет" — Кт 51 "Расчетный счет" (на сумму в рублях)
Дт 91.02 "Прочие расходы" — Кт 51 "Расчетный счет" (на сумму комиссии банка)